- Updated: 14:13 Kimi Raikkonen believes Ferrari has made a clear step forward with its power unit this season. The Ferrari-powered teams, the Scuderia, Alfa Romeo and Haas, struggled on high-speed circuits and tracks with long straights last year as a consequence of technical directives issued by the FIA regarding the Ferrari system at the end of 2019. Article continues under video Alfa Romeo driver Raikkonen has revealed he has been able to feel an improvement in the new Ferrari power unit so far this season. “For sure we have a bit more horsepower and definitely, it is a step forward," said the Finn “It is better compared to last year.
